Transaction 80950c167f3c2aeb7c0594553f18cda86ab42a6dab3ae462c61544a4d48729e8
1 Input
1 Output
-
80950c167f3c2aeb7c0594553f18cda86ab42a6dab3ae462c61544a4d48729e8:0
- value
- 32316
- script pubkey
- OP_0 OP_PUSHBYTES_20 7f644161ecebb32dfb382e3554afcafd0e2e7285
- address
- bc1q0ajyzc0vawejm7ec9c64ft72l58zuu59c870el